How Access vcenter from internet

I have Dell emc poweredge r240 and I setup vmware esxi 6.5 on it and vcenter server 6.5

I need to access Vcenter from internet or from outside my home network

7 Replies
ashilkrishnan
VMware Employee
VMware Employee

Hi

Exposing vCenter to public address/internet is not a secure option, instead you should configure some VPN your system.
